Cleanspade 3,324 Posted June 17, 2011 Report Share Posted June 17, 2011 if you are into shooting with an air rifle and shotgun. a gundog breed would suit you better. but if your set on a lurcher that will retrieve shot foxes. a good greyhound cross is the way to go. i cant believe folk are recomending a beddy/whippet for this. if you think it through the guns will take work away from a lurcher. a terrier will give the bonus of shifting a fox from ground or tight cover. i'd opt for a work bred plummer. gundog. or greyhound based lurcher. collie cross would be my choice. good luck whatever you choose Quote Link to post
